Based on the Scheherazade’s narration the authors of the new production for the youngest children made their sea history: in fact, it is actually about three classic fairy (The Ugly Duckling, The Tale of the Fisherman and the Fish, The Tale of the Cockerel and the Hen) in a slightly unusual presentation.

A pair of sailors-storekeepers are getting hungry in the lower deck of an ocean liner. They decide to comfort the hunger with not a very commendable way – in transport boxes around them are a lot of animals ready to be consumed. The chosen (and tasty) animals not only do not want to be eaten but they belong to an unnamed circus and they can even talk. And this is what saves their “skin”. Each of the endangered animal narrates its life story to the sailors and so they have to fulfill the promises either they wanted or not and feed themselves differently.
 
Awards:
FESTIVAL MATEŘINKA 2013: Prize for direction (Jakub Vašíček) and Honorable mention for script (Tomáš Jarkovský and Jakub Vašíček).
